Personnaliser l’affichage d’un site Joomla! sans recourir à un plugin lourd devient une pratique répandue chez les administrateurs depuis quelques années. Cette approche privilégie les overrides et les frameworks visuels, permettant d’adapter un template sans modifier le noyau.
Le propos ici est concret et orienté vers l’action, avec des étapes, des tableaux et des retours d’expérience vérifiables. Les éléments présentés mènent naturellement vers les choix pratiques et les paramètres à vérifier pour déployer une override efficace.
A retenir :
- Méthodes de copie et duplication complètes de templates Joomla
- Utilisation de frameworks visuels pour personnaliser sans codage
- Conseils pratiques pour design responsive et optimisation mobile
- Comparaison des alternatives et plugins légers pour personnalisation
Créer et dupliquer un template Joomla sans code
Ce passage reprend l’idée d’organisation et de sauvegarde exposée précédemment pour éviter toute perte de données. Selon Joomla Documentation, la duplication protège les fichiers et facilite les tests avant mise en production.
La gestion passe par le gestionnaire de templates ou par une copie manuelle des fichiers située dans /templates. Avant toute opération, effectuer une sauvegarde complète de la base et des fichiers reste une pratique incontournable.
Choix de personnalisation :
- Copie de style pour tester rapidement un rendu
- Copie complète pour préserver l’ensemble des fichiers
- Duplication manuelle pour contrôle fin des fichiers
Framework
Fournisseur
Fonctionnalités
Popularité
Astroid
Templaza
Création de colonnes, gestion des menus
Élevée
Gantry
RocketTheme
Substitutions et personnalisation poussée
Élevée
Helix Ultimate
JoomShaper
Options de couleurs et responsive design
Élevée
T3 Framework
JoomlArt
Dispositions multiples et plugins
Moyenne
Procédure en un clic pour dupliquer un template
Ce point se rattache directement à la copie rapide mentionnée plus haut et sert aux tests visuels. L’option de duplication en un clic conserve les styles et les fichiers de configuration essentiels.
Pour l’utiliser, accéder au gestionnaire de templates, cliquer sur « Copier le template » et fournir un nouveau nom. Vérifier ensuite la duplication dans la base de données et tester le rendu sur des pages types.
Méthode manuelle pour une personnalisation fine
Ce sous-ensemble s’appuie sur la copie détaillée des fichiers du template dans /templates/[nom]/html. Copier les fichiers XML, PHP et les fichiers de langue permet de contrôler précisément chaque composant.
Cette méthode demande un accès FTP et une bonne organisation des dossiers, mais elle évite les effets secondaires liés aux duplications automatiques. L’ultime étape consiste à tester sur un environnement de développement avant mise en production.
« La copie manuelle m’a permis une personnalisation fine. »
Alex N.
Frameworks visuels pour personnaliser sans coder
Ce H2 fait suite à la duplication et montre comment les frameworks réduisent la nécessité de coder. Selon RocketTheme, les frameworks offrent des zones configurables qui accélèrent la personnalisation visuelle.
Les frameworks comme Helix Ultimate, YOOtheme, SP Page Builder et Astroid proposent des options pour les couleurs, polices et mises en page. L’usage de ces outils simplifie la création de lignes et colonnes adaptées aux modules.
Avantages pratiques :
- Gestion de lignes et colonnes sans code
- Modification rapide des couleurs et polices
- Options responsive pour mobiles intégrées
- Interface de style simple et intuitive
Fonctionnalités communes des frameworks
Ce point se rattache à l’ergonomie et décrit les contrôles accessibles depuis une interface. Les frameworks fournissent des panneaux pour menus, fonds, typographies et positions de modules.
Ils comportent aussi des options de sauvegarde et des presets qui accélèrent le prototypage. Pour les équipes réduites, ces outils représentent une économie de temps notable.
Retours d’expérience d’utilisateurs
Ce passage illustre l’impact concret sur des sites réels à travers des témoignages d’utilisateurs. Plusieurs web designers affirment que l’utilisation d’un framework a transformé leur flux de travail sans recourir au code.
La documentation et la communauté autour de YOOtheme, JoomShaper et TemplateMonster facilitent la montée en compétence rapide. Selon TemplateMonster, ces ressources sont souvent accompagnées de modèles et guides prêts à l’emploi.
« L’utilisation d’un framework a changé ma manière de concevoir un site sans coder. »
Marie N.
Les frameworks réduisent la charge technique pour les équipes non développeuses et favorisent l’expérimentation rapide. Ce bénéfice prépare l’étape suivante, l’import d’overrides spécifiques dans un template.
Importer et activer une override dans Joomla étape par étape
Ce H2 prend la suite logique et décrit l’import d’une override dans un template Joomla natif ou tiers. Selon Joomla Documentation, une override est un fichier placé dans le dossier html du template qui prend le pas sur l’affichage par défaut.
Procéder par étapes claires évite les erreurs courantes lors du déploiement en production. Un bon test local ou sur un serveur de préproduction garantit un comportement identique avant publication.
Étapes d’import :
- Télécharger l’archive contenant l’override depuis une source fiable
- Se connecter en FTP et ouvrir le dossier /templates/[nom]/html
- Déposer le fichier PHP d’override dans le dossier correspondant
- Ajouter les règles CSS dans custom.css si nécessaire
| Étape | Action | Dossier cible | Remarque |
|---|---|---|---|
| 1 | Ouvrir le client FTP et se connecter au serveur | /public_html | Utiliser FileZilla ou équivalent |
| 2 | Accéder au dossier du template actif | /templates/[nom-de-votre-template]/html | Créer le dossier si absent |
| 3 | Uploader le fichier override-xxx.php | /html/mod_articles_news | Vérifier les permissions après transfert |
| 4 | Copier les règles CSS dans custom.css | /templates/[nom]/css | Utiliser user.css si template Protostar |
Importer un fichier d’override depuis un ZIP
Ce point traite de l’import automatisé et s’aligne sur le protocole d’upload sécurisé préalablement décrit. Télécharger le ZIP fourni par l’auteur, extraire localement et repérer le fichier PHP nommé selon l’override.
Ensuite, déposer le fichier dans le dossier du template via FTP et valider la présence depuis l’administration Joomla. Sélectionner le nouveau type d’affichage dans le gestionnaire de modules pour appliquer l’override.
Activation, test et bonnes pratiques
Ce segment permet d’assurer que l’override s’applique correctement sur les pages ciblées et prépare la maintenance future. Tester sur plusieurs navigateurs et appareils révèle les régressions potentielles côté responsive.
Documenter chaque override dans un fichier README interne aide les équipes à comprendre les personnalisations réalisées. Selon RocketTheme, la bonne pratique consiste à conserver un historique des modifications pour faciliter les retours en arrière.
« Les alternatives m’ont permis de gagner du temps tout en ayant un rendu professionnel. »
Thomas N.
« Importer l’override et le tester sur un site de staging évite les problèmes en production. »
Paul N.
Après activation, vérifier les positions de module, les couleurs et la typographie en lien avec Helix Ultimate ou SP Page Builder. Un contrôle final sur mobile et tablette conclut la procédure et sécurise le déploiement.
Source : Joomla Documentation, « Substitutions de template », Joomla! ; RocketTheme, « How to Override in Gantry », RocketTheme ; TemplateMonster, « Modify Joomla template without coding », TemplateMonster.